HP [HP UNIX B.10.20] NFS Client SubSystem fail

Recently moved a HP Unix B.10.20 system from US to Thailand, and everything is work well in US but after we changed:

1. set_parms ip_address (change the IP to TH range)
2. set_parms addl_netwrk (change the Subnet, Gateway, Domain name, DNS Svr Name, and DNS IP)
3. vi /etc/hosts (to commented entries and add new enteries.)

After rebooted encountered NFS Client Subsystem fail* during the post screen. Check the /etc/rc.log and it shown:


starting up the Automount daemon /usr/sbin/automount -f /etc/auto_master FAILURE CODE:1 mounting remote NFS file system.... "/sbin/rc2.d/S430nfs.client start" FAILED

Check if the NFS server has exported the share to the new client address you have setuped.

If you do not require the NFS mountpoint in question, you will need to comment it out or delete it from /etc/auto_master file or an equivalent file, depending on the content of /etc/auto_master.

The NFS server as a remote server (not the client - your server) which shared the path via NFS is not available or is restricting the access to your client (your server).

This has nothing with NFS server on your host, your host is the client to NFS server.

mounting remote NFS file system
Is your NFS server available on the new location ?
